Cispus River Ab Yellowjacket Creek near Randle, WA

Cispus River Ab Yellowjacket Creek near Randle, WA is USGS streamgage 14231900 in Washington, monitoring river discharge in hydrologic subbasin 17080004. It drains a watershed of about 250 square miles. Discharge records at this site go back to 1996. Typical flow runs near 712.2 cfs in July and 1,208.3 cfs in April, with the higher of the two arriving in April. Typical flow by month

Long-term daily discharge percentiles from the USGS record (up to 30 years of data), averaged within each month. These describe the historical normal range — they are not a forecast and not today's reading.

Historical monthly discharge percentiles in cubic feet per second
Month Low p10 Typical p50 High p90 Range
January 576.6 1,059.9 2,258.1
February 526.8 862.6 1,954.3
March 522.3 898.1 2,008.7
April 719 1,208.3 1,877
May 1,084.2 1,699 3,050.3
June 756.6 1,435.5 2,714.3
July 471.2 712.2 1,487.8
August 344.8 453.6 701.4
September 269.4 367.2 539.1
October 256.8 390.9 846.1
November 356.6 790.5 2,000
December 454.2 910.8 2,322.6

All values in cubic feet per second (cfs).

Common questions

When does Cispus River Ab Yellowjacket Creek near Randle, WA normally run highest?
May, on the long-term record. The median daily flow that month is about 1,699 cfs, against 367.2 cfs in September, the lowest month. These are historical normals for the date, not a forecast and not today's reading.
What is a normal flow for Cispus River Ab Yellowjacket Creek near Randle, WA?
It depends on the month. In January, half of days historically fall near 1,059.9 cfs, with the middle 80% of days between 576.6 and 2,258.1 cfs. The month-by-month table on this page gives the full range.
How long has Cispus River Ab Yellowjacket Creek near Randle, WA been measured?
Discharge records at USGS site 14231900 begin in 1996, about 30 years, covering roughly 9,200 days of published daily values. The long record is what makes the monthly percentiles on this page meaningful.
